After reading a forwarded message earlier today inviting us to support the 
campaign to
improve the Library in the latest Winamp, I decided to upgrade from 5.13 to 
get an idea of
exactly what was being requested.
Since 2.95 (or perhaps earlier) I have installed each new version over the 
top of the old and
everything has always gone smoothly - but not today.  Twice I have tried to 
install 5.20 only
to lose speech as it is unpacking files and installing.  The system appeared 
to crash and I
have had to re-boot.
i have now gone back to 5.13 but would be interested to know whether anyone 
else has had
difficulty in installing 5.20.
